What is the name of the angle between the horizon and the polar axis?

Explanation:
The angle between the horizon and the polar axis equals your latitude. The polar axis points toward the celestial pole, and the altitude of that pole above the horizon at your location is exactly how far north or south you are. At the equator the pole is on the horizon (zero degrees), and at higher latitudes it rises higher, up to 90 degrees at the North Pole. Altitude is about how high a specific object is above the horizon, not the pole itself. Declination is a coordinate on the celestial sphere, not a measure from your horizon to the pole. Co-altitude isn’t the standard term used here. So the described angle is your latitude.
